Although we have formed a start-up team at this stage, as ACHN starts to take shape, we would like to involve more scholars in the field to join ACHN and promote Asian construction history with us.

Considering the population diversity, ethnicity and religious divergence, cultural interactions, and multicultural influences in Asia, we wish to include representatives from different geographical regions and building cultures of Asia. “Asian Construction History Network” makes “Asian” as an adjective to describe the “Construction History” relating to Asia or its people, culture, tradition. Not only promotes it the research on “construction history in Asia”, but also allows overseas Asians/Asian immigrants in Australia, Europe, and North America as well as all parties interested in studying the history of construction in Asia to promote and facilitate the study of the Asian-influenced construction history abroad. Therefore, we also welcome scholars interested in this field of study, who are based outside of Asia.
